Neibauer Presents ‘Seven Principles of Unconditional Responsibility’
By Susan Larson
Dr. Chris Neibauer will discuss his “Seven Principals of Unconditional Responsibility” at a September 16 event to benefit Startup Weekend Fredericksburg and Made in FredVa.
The longtime Fredericksburg-area resident built Neibauer Dental Care into a healthcare business with annual revenues exceeding $60 million. His presentation will focus on entrepreneurship and what it takes to achieve success.
